    CSS help needed

    here is my problem
    I have this css class
    .table_header {
    color: #FFA34F; font-size: 12; font-weight : bold;
    background-color: #006699; height: 25px;
    text-align: center;


    }

    I use it like this:

    tr class="table_header"

    as you can see the background color is blue (almost blue)

    my default color for links is blue and I'd like to change the link color within the table_header class

    I tried
    .table_header:link {
    color: white; font-size: 12; font-weight : bold;
    background-color: #006699; height: 25px;
    text-align: center;


    }

    but that didn't work

    any ideas?
  • The Truth Hurts
    Zph7YXfjMhg
    • Nov 2002
    • 15734

    #2
    .table_header a:link {defined here}
    .table_header a:visited {defined here}
    .table_header a:hover {defined here}
    .table_header a:active {defined here}

      Try this, edit the elements to suit.


      .table_header { font-family: Verdana, Arial, Helvetica, Sans-Serif; font-size: 10px; color: #FFFFFF;}
      .table_header a { color: #FFFFFF; text-decoration: none;}
      .table_header a:hover { color: #486582; text-decoration: none;}
      .table_header a:active { color: #FFFFFF; text-decoration: none;}

          or you could:

          a.linkstyle1:link {style attributes}
          a.linkstyle1:visited {style attributes}
          etc.

          it works but it's more of a pain in the ass because you have to add class="linkstyle1" to each of your links.
